Specifications
Comparison of all specifications
Xeon E3-1240L v5 | SpecificationsComparison of all specifications | Core i7-12700KF |
---|---|---|
General | ||
Oct 19th, 2015 | Release Date | Nov 4th, 2021 |
$278.00 | MSRP | $384.00 |
Server | Segment | Desktop |
Intel Socket 1151 | Socket | Intel Socket 1700 |
Skylake | Codename | Alder Lake |
25 W | Power Consumption | 125 W |
Performance | ||
4 | Cores | 12 |
8 | Threads | 20 |
2.1 GHz | Base Frequency | 3.6 GHz |
3.2 GHz | Turbo Frequency | 5.0 GHz |
8 MB | L3 Cache | 25 MB |
Other Features | ||
DDR3 @ 2133 MHz, DDR4 @ 2133 MHz | RAM | DDR4 @ 3200 MHz, DDR5 @ 4800 MHz |
No | Integrated Graphics | No |
No | Overclockable | Yes |
